Finance Review Summary — Insurance Renewal

The annual renewal of the Marwick Group policy with Haleford Mutual concluded within budget, though premiums rose eleven percent, reflecting the expanded Dunsley warehouse cover. Deductibles remain unchanged; cyber riders were added at modest cost. We recommend the incoming director review exclusions before the next cycle. Broader context on our commercial direction follows immediately below.

board note of bajop-yaweg: The western region missed its Pelys quota by 58.0 percent last quarter. Pelysek Foods plans to raise the Belius list price by 44.0 percent in July. The steering committee signed off on a budget of $133.8 million for Project Pelax. The renewal with Zoraelix Systems closes at $61.9 million a year, 12.7 percent above the last contract.

## Deployment

The Lumacache image service has a known slow leak in its thumbnail cache layer: evicted entries keep a reference alive through the decoder pool, so resident memory creeps up roughly 40 MB per hour under steady load. Until the refactor in the Harkness branch lands, we mitigate by capping pool size and scheduling a rolling restart every 12 hours. Deploy with the supervisor, never bare, or the restart hook won't fire. The deployment relies on the configuration values listed below.

settings of bagug-tahof:
holath:
  pin: 7837
  metrics_host: metrics.holath.tolvaqsys.internal
  tenant: quenath
  seal: seal_6001b3af

Q3 Regional Sales Review — Veltrane Group. The Marrowdale and Kestwick branches exceeded targets by 6% and 4% respectively, driven by strong uptake of the Clarion fittings line. Ostbridge underperformed due to delayed stock transfers, now resolved. Margins held steady overall despite freight costs. Branch managers should review attached variance sheets before the November call. The following note is confidential and informs next quarter's planning.

confidential, kagup-bafog: Fraaxax Group is in early talks to buy Soroxox Group for about $343.8 million. The Olidor launch date is June 14, and nothing goes to the press before then. Legal wants the Aldmirek Logistics term sheet signed before July 23.